Bishopthorpe Lane (not Bishopthorpe Road) Drain Damaged & Blocked
Reported in the Gully/Drainage category by Stuart Taylor at 17:13, Fri 14 August 2020
Sent to Bristol City Council less than a minute later. FixMyStreet ref: 2245909.
This drain has been broken and is full of crap. It was repaired between 5 and 10 years ago but they chose to use a plastic grill instead of the original metal type, which lasted less than a year before it began to crack and fall apart. Over the years we've been clearing up pieces of it as it broke apart.
The main sewer/street drains that it runs into have been flushed through by Wessex Water 4 times over the past 10 years, and they always tell me that this damaged gully is a huge contributory factor to the sewer blockages.
The arrow placement is not exact on the map probably because the Bishopthorpe Lane was only named about 6 or 7 years ago.
